Abstract

The utility model provides a tool magazine cam indexing mechanism, includes: motor, mounting bracket, cam, transmission shaft, blade disc, blade disc axis, sword proximity switch, adjusting block, the motor is fixed to mounting bracket one end, mounting bracket other end lower part is uncovered and have a vertical baffle to keep apart uncovered of mounting bracket for relatively independent cavity in the middle part of the mounting bracket, the cam is fixed in the uncovered portion of mounting bracket through the bearing rotation of its both sides, camshaft one end is stretched out the baffle and is connected with the transmission shaft, it is used for adjusting axial internal clearance to be equipped with round annular adjusting block between its tip of bearing of camshaft other end department and the mounting bracket, the output shaft of transmission shaft and motor, sword proximity switch sets up on the mounting bracket of transmission shaft top. The utility model discloses an unsteady push -pull institution of cancellation directly installs the cam on the mounting bracket to with the adjusting block guarantee axial internal clearance make the structure reasonable more, simplify, improved reliability and convenient to detach under the original precision prerequisite of product not reducing.

Tool magazine cam indexing mechanism
Technical field:
This utility model relates to numerical control machine tool technique field, particularly to the tool magazine cam of numerical control machine tool changer system Indexing mechanism.
Background technology:
Tool magazine system is to provide in automatization's course of processing required storage cutter and a kind of device of tool changing demand.Its Automatic tool changer and can store the tool magazine of much knives tool, changes tradition with the artificial main mode of production. By the control of computer program, various different process requirements can be completed, as milling, boring, bore hole, Tappings etc., significantly shorten processing time-histories, reduce production cost, and this is the maximum feature of tool magazine system.
Tool magazine system mainly provides storage cutter position, and can be according to the control of formula, and correct selection cutter is determined Position, to carry out Tool changeover;Cutter-exchange mechanism is then carried out the action of Tool changeover.Tool magazine system presses its structure Form can be divided into: bamboo hat type tool holder system, chain-type tool magazine system and disc type tool magazine system.
As it is shown in figure 1, existing disc type tool magazine system includes: motor 1, installing rack 2, floating push-and-pull machine Structure 3, cam 4, power transmission shaft 5, cutterhead 6, cutterhead axis 7, cutter proximity switch 8;Wherein, installing rack Motor 1 is fixed in 2 one end, and installing rack 2 other end lower removable is fixed with floating push-pull mechanism 3, floating push-and-pull Mechanism 3 bottom is uncovered, threadeds with installing rack 2 and floating push-pull mechanism 3 in floating push-pull mechanism 3 top Top is also by from the vertical pretightning force of jackscrew 9 on installing rack 2, the cam 4 bearing 10 by its both sides It is internal that rotation is fixed on floating push-pull mechanism 3, and floating push-pull mechanism 3 and power transmission shaft are stretched out in camshaft 11 one end 5 connect, and power transmission shaft 5 is connected with the output shaft of motor 1 by gear train 12, and cutter proximity switch 8 is arranged On installing rack 2 above power transmission shaft 5, cutterhead 6 bearing is arranged on cutterhead axis 7, and cutterhead 6 is positioned at Below cam 4, indexing roller 13 is positioned at cam 4 bottom notch.
Owing to using floating push-pull mechanism, this camshaft bearing seat is floating type, adjusts bearing block with jackscrew and makes Power transmission shaft and camshaft gap and balance, because not having benchmark, be difficult to measure, the most parallel, shadow Ring cam and indexing roller linear contact lay, thus reduce transmission efficiency, cam card master can be made time serious, need dimension Repair and could use.And owing to cam axial gap floating push-pull mechanism ensures, and screw, jackscrew position Put mutability, can cause each dismounting all can be different.It addition, arrange floating push-pull mechanism, add zero Number of packages amount, and then add the complexity of tool magazine system, it is not easy to detachable maintaining in the future.
Summary of the invention:
In consideration of it, be necessary that design is a kind of reliable, compact, failure rate is low and easy-to-dismount tool magazine cam divide Degree mechanism.
A kind of tool magazine cam indexing mechanism, including: motor, installing rack, cam, power transmission shaft, cutterhead, cutter Dish axis, cutter proximity switch, adjustment block;Wherein, motor, the installing rack other end are fixed in installing rack one end Bottom is uncovered and has a vertical dividing plate that uncovered for installing rack portion is isolated into relatively independent chamber in the middle part of installing rack Room, cam is rotated by the bearing of its both sides and is fixed on the uncovered portion of installing rack, camshaft one end stretch out dividing plate with Power transmission shaft connects, and is provided with a ring shape adjustment block between the bearing at the camshaft other end its end and installing rack For adjusting end-play, during installation, first give the thickness that then the certain pretightning force of bearing determines adjustment block, Mixing up post gap never to change, power transmission shaft is connected with the output shaft of motor, and cutter proximity switch is arranged on transmission On installing rack above axle, cutterhead bearing is connected on cutterhead axis, and cutterhead is positioned at below cam, indexing rolling Wheel is positioned at cam bottom notch.
Preferably, tool magazine cam indexing mechanism also includes that zero-bit proximity switch, zero-bit proximity switch are arranged on biography On installing rack above moving axis.Zero-bit proximity switch detection tool magazine every revolution sends a signal.
Preferably, power transmission shaft is connected with the output shaft of motor by gear train.
Preferably, motor is retarding braking motor.
Cam, by cancelling floating push-pull mechanism, is directly arranged on installing rack by this utility model, and to adjust Monoblock ensure end-play make structure more rationally, simplify, owing to decreasing part and assembling quantity, Assembly precision can be ensured by processing, improves reliability under not reducing product original precision premise, And it is readily accessible.
